A continuous 100 mile circumnavigation of Dartmoor along the waymarked Dartmoor Way, with six indoor checkpoints, GPS tracking and a 34 hour time limit. Entry requires age 21 plus a prior 50 mile finish within the qualifying period.

A six hour looped race in the Lower Otter valley on a 4.4 km circuit. Solo and pairs relay options, aid station every loop, plus on-site cafe, bar and hot showers.

A seven hour Time Challenge at Dare Valley Country Park offering flexible lap-based distances, finisher medals and pins, aid stations with snacks and vegan options, goody bags and free parking.

A short fell race from the Storey Arms lay-by on the A470, covering about 3.2 km with 305 m of ascent; the course requires experience and navigational skills. Entry is £2 on the day and junior races are to be confirmed.

A trail half marathon in the Quantock Hills on 4 October 2026, featuring technical forest trails, moorland and stream crossings, with marshals, two feed stations, awards and weekend camping and bunk house options.

A lap-based trail event at Mill Marsh Park on 04 October 2026, with a 5.3 km lap that can be repeated for distances from 5 km to ultra. Flexible start times, a 7 hour time limit, and medal or lower-cost no-medal entry options are offered.

A fully marked 32 mile trail run in the Cambrian Mountains, based at Camp Plas with exclusive camping and support, limited to 100 runners and a 14 hours cut off for the main route.

A 55 km circular trail in the Forest of Dean that requires GPX navigation across single track, ridges and riverside sections. The event offers staffed aid stations, canicross category, support vehicles and a finishers medal.

A 24 hour looped endurance event in Haldon Forest where runners complete one lap every hour and choose distances from 10k to ultramarathon. The final lap decides the winners and all participants receive wooden medals.

A new fell race on the Cat's Back ridge in the Black Mountains covering about 11.7 km with 492 m ascent. The partly marked, rocky route requires full kit and appropriate fell shoes and is open to runners aged 16 and over.

A community off road running event in Marshfield on Sunday 11 October 2026 with children's and adult distances. Entries support Marshfield Primary School and the routes use temporary access across private land.
